Last summer my friends and I had a fantastic experience in Kenya. We had the good luck of having Richard as our tour guide with whom we could talk in Spanish but we could practice our English too.
We did a 5 day tour which started at Nairobi airport. Richard came to pick us up at the airport and from there he took us to Naivasha. I still remember the excitement of seeing our first giraffe on the way, it was fantastic! In Naivasha we rode a boat and walked amongst some of the animals, close enough to see them but far enough away so as not to be in danger.
From there we went to the lodge in Nakuru where we had lunch and went on our first safari.
From Nakuru we went to Masai Mara. There we stayed in a camp with well equipped and quite comfortable tents. Everything was spectacular, we saw the big five, we laughed a lot during the safaris, we ate in the shade of a tree in the middle of the reserve, we learned a lot about animals and culture and we were even helping or rather, giving conversation to a family that had had a car breakdown in the reserve.
We spent unforgettable moments doing the safaris but also chatting with the Maasai at the lodge, learning Swahili and teaching them Spanish so that they could show off to future Spanish guests and name the food in Spanish. On the last day we were able to greet and name the food in Swahili even though "thank you and you're welcome" got a bit mixed up - what great memories!
